Er:YAG and Ho:YAG laser beams were combined to irradiate hard tissues to achieve highly efficient ablation with low laser power. The delay time between pulses of the two lasers was controlled to irradiate alumina ceramic balls used as hard tissue models. Focused laser ablation by single laser pulses at varying angles of incidence is studied in two materials of interest: a solgel ~Ormocer 4! and a polymer ~SU8!. For a range of angles ~up to 70° from normal!, and for low-energy ~,20 mJ!, 40 ns pulses at 266 nm wavelength, the ablation depth along the direction of the incident laser beam is found to be independent of the angle of incidence. The ablation mechanism of fresh porcine skin has been studied using nanosecond laser pulses at the wavelengths of 1064, 532, 266, and 213 nm. We have identified the Na spectral line at 589 nm in the secondary radiation from the ablated skin sample as the signature of tissue ablation and measured the ablation probability near ablation threshold. In the nanosecond laser ablation regime, absorption of laser energy by the plasma during its early stage expansion critically influences the properties of the plasma and thus its interaction with ambient air.
